>    1.  when using the upload button to move mtz/sca files into
>    /datafiles/ for a 5.4Mb sca file (unmerged) I get a 
>    perl error cgi suggesting im tryin to upload to large 
>    a file
> 
>    Request to receive too much data: 5563834 bytes

That is something the underlying Perl code has: see

  $BDG_home/sushi/cgi-bin/upload.cgi

I set the MAXLENGTH value to 5242880 - maybe you can increase that?

>    also when i use this sca file (unmerged) i get this error message
>    ERROR   : unable to determine format of SCALEPACK file "junk1.sca"

Have you specified (in the first autoSHARP panel) that you are using
unmerged SCALEPACK data?

Or maybe something has changed in the format of those files in the
scalepack program ...

In general: there is not much advantage in using unmerged SCALEPACK
files in the current autoSHARP version (most of the work is then done
on merged data anyway). See

  http://www.globalphasing.com/sharp/manual/autoSHARP1.html#datafiles

for details.
